What Is Invisalign?
Invisalign is a FDA-cleared system that relies on a sequence of custom-made, removable plastic aligners to move your check here teeth incrementally over several months. Unlike metal braces, each aligner sits flush against your teeth when worn, making it an appealing alternative for adults who want discreet treatment.
The engineering inside invisalign center on controlled force. Each aligner you receive is fractionally repositioned from the one before it, exerting precise force to specific teeth. Over a defined period, your teeth respond to that pressure outlined in your digital treatment plan. The Invisalign system uses proprietary thermoplastic that seals comfortably to each tooth surface for consistent force delivery.
Every 10-14 days, patients move to the next aligner in the series. Regular monitoring appointments at our office allow our providers to make any needed adjustments. Today's intraoral scanning technology — which we use rather than putty trays — creates the precise data needed to design each tray before you wear a single aligner.
Why Patients Choose Invisalign of Invisalign
- Discreet, Clear Design: The smooth thermoplastic trays are difficult to spot at normal conversational distance, making invisalign popular among working professionals.
- Take Them Out at Meals: Because the aligners can be taken out, you enjoy your normal diet during treatment — no changes to what's on your plate.
- Simpler Daily Cleaning: Removing your aligners lets you clean your teeth without obstacles — a significant advantage over fixed braces, where food gets trapped.
- Reduced Irritation: The smooth plastic edges don't cut or scratch your cheeks and gums the way traditional orthodontic hardware sometimes do.
- Predictable, Mapped-Out Results: Your 3D treatment simulation lets you preview your new smile before treatment begins.
- Fewer Office Visits: Invisalign typically requires less time in the chair than traditional braces, which suits patients with demanding routines.
- Treats a Wide Range of Issues: From mild spacing to complex arch-length discrepancies, invisalign handles a broad spectrum than patients often assume.
- Safe for Sensitive Patients: The medical-grade thermoplastic eliminates concerns about nickel sensitivity that sometimes arise from traditional braces.
The Invisalign Treatment Journey Step by Step
-
Initial Consultation and Smile Assessment
The process kicks off with a detailed orthodontic assessment. Our providers examine your overall oral health and tooth position and discuss your smile goals. Clinical documentation allow us to evaluate your current alignment.
-
3D Scanning and Digital Treatment Planning
Using advanced 3D imaging technology, we capture a detailed digital model of your teeth. This feeds directly into your ClinCheck treatment plan, which shows each incremental shift of your invisalign treatment.
-
Aligner Fabrication and Delivery
Your precision-trimmed sets are manufactured at an Invisalign-certified lab and delivered to our office within a few weeks. At your tray pickup, we confirm the fit — clear composite anchors that assist with precise rotation and torque.
-
Committing to Your Treatment Schedule
Invisalign works only when worn — the standard recommendation is at least 20-22 hours daily. You remove them to eat and reinsert them promptly. According to your custom plan, you move to the following aligner.
-
Progress Check Appointments
Every 6-8 weeks, you come in for a quick check so our clinicians can verify movement is on schedule. Check-ins are typically short but important for catching issues early.
-
Reaching Your Last Tray
Once you wear through your final aligner, our team reviews your actual results against the original digital plan. The majority of cases reach the planned outcome with strong fidelity.
-
Retainer Wear and Long-Term Maintenance
Post-treatment retention protects everything you've accomplished. Your bite wants to return toward the original position without regular retainer use. We fit you with a removable retention appliance and outline exactly how often to wear it.
Who Is a Strong Candidate for Invisalign?
Invisalign benefits a wide range of patients. Ideal candidates are older adolescents and grown-ups with bite problems in a certain range of severity. Problems that respond to clear aligner therapy include crowded teeth, gaps, overbites and mild skeletal imbalances. Anyone willing to keep the aligners 22 hours daily tend to finish on schedule.
Some cases, however, are more appropriate for invisalign. Significant structural bite problems — where orthopedic movement is needed — may require traditional braces or orthopedic appliances instead. Children under 12 or 13 are often treated with different appliances until most adult teeth have come in. Patients who won't commit to consistent wear may see slower progress.

Invisalign FAQ
How long does invisalign treatment take?How long it takes depends on the severity of misalignment. The average patient is done in 12 to 18 months, though mild cases can resolve in as few as 6 months or less. Severe misalignment may take closer to 18-24 months. Your digital simulation shows the expected duration during your consultation.
Is invisalign painful?The experience is rarely described as painful, though a feeling of tightness are normal early in each switch. This generally passes within a couple of days. Common analgesics work well if needed. The polished borders of the trays also mean less soft tissue irritation than traditional braces.
How much does invisalign cost?Pricing depends on several factors based on the scope of movement required. In broad terms, full invisalign treatment typically costs between $3,000 and $7,000 in most markets. Several PPO plans cover a portion of the cost — up to $1,500 or more. How long do invisalign results last?Properly retained results last a lifetime — when patients use their retainers as directed. Biology doesn't stop after treatment ends, so wearing your retainer consistently is non-negotiable. Most patients wear retainers nightly for the foreseeable future preserves your investment in a straight smile.
Can invisalign fix my bite, or just spacing?Clear aligners address spacing and bite concerns. Aligners effectively address class I, II, and III bite relationships in the right patient. Complex skeletal misalignment may need a different approach. Your provider determines what specifically invisalign can correct for you.
